Ticket TRC-451: Heads up — the Spanwire tracing collector is rejecting spans from the checkout service with a signature mismatch. Looks like that service shipped before the cert swap, so every cross-service trace it touches gets dropped. Support folks: tell affected customers traces will backfill once we redeploy. The redeploy needs signing first; use the key below.

rollout seal: bky9_PeXH1fTLY

**Vendor note: Inkmill markdown pipeline**

Rendering for Parchway docs is outsourced to Inkmill under an annual contract, renewing each March. They handle sanitization and PDF export; we own the upload queue. SLA: 4-hour response on rendering failures. Escalate only after two failed retries. Their support desk is reachable at the address below.

billing contact of hahaf-baguf = zorael.tammir.jorius@sivrelhq.internal

# Break-Glass: Catalog Cache Invalidation

Scope: the Pinrow product catalog at Veldstone Retail. If stale prices persist after a purge and the Hollowmere invalidation queue is wedged, use break-glass to flush the edge tier directly. Contractors: get verbal sign-off from the catalog lead first. Steps: open the Hollowmere admin shell, select emergency-flush, confirm the tenant, and run it once — repeated flushes thrash the origin. Access is logged and expires after 20 minutes. Unseal the admin shell with the passphrase below.

recovery phrase for kahop-tajog: istix-casvan

Handover for the Crashbin pipeline. It ingests crash reports from the Petrel mobile app, batches them, and ships summaries to triage. Watch the queue depth; anything over 10k means the parser is stuck. Restarting the worker usually fixes it. Talk to Dara for access. Current production config follows.

config for hahif-yahop:
[istox]
port = 9000
region = central-3
host = istox.zarqelnet.test
team = noviel
timeout_ms = 500
retries = 5

- [ ] **Guest Wi-Fi desk, reception (new starter, Day 1)** — Contractors supporting a new starter at Thistledown Court: bring them to the guest Wi-Fi desk to the left of reception before 09:30, where Front-of-House will issue a temporary network voucher and a day lanyard. The desk is unstaffed between 12:30 and 13:15, so plan around lunch. The starter must sign the equipment sheet before touching any loaned kit. To release the desk drawer containing vouchers, enter the code below.

door code, yagap-bahof: bdg-O-05